This paper is about automatic speech recognition system for controlling specific tasks with the help of a certain number of voice commands. It primarily deals with enhancing the accuracy of the voice based automation system. The feature extraction of speech has been done by the MFCC (Mel Frequency Cepstral Coefficients) and testing or matching has been performed with the help of ANN (Artificial Neural Networks). For enhancing the performance Euclidean distance is also measured to reject the unauthorized voice commands. |
